Hefei Documentary Cinematographers represent a specialized group of visual storytellers dedicated to capturing authentic narratives and real-life experiences through the art of documentary filmmaking. Based in Hefei, the capital of Anhui Province in China, these cinematographers have developed a unique approach to documenting the rich cultural heritage, social transformations, and personal stories that define the region. Their work goes beyond mere recording—they craft visual narratives that resonate with audiences on emotional and intellectual levels, bringing to light stories that might otherwise remain untold. The documentary cinematographers in Hefei employ various techniques to create immersive experiences for viewers. They master the use of natural lighting to enhance authenticity, carefully compose shots to convey specific emotions, and utilize camera movements that draw audiences into the story. Many specialize in observational documentary styles, where they become invisible observers capturing life as it unfolds, while others engage in participatory filmmaking, building relationships with their subjects over extended periods. This dedication to their craft has positioned Hefei as an emerging hub for documentary production in Eastern China. The city’s unique blend of traditional Chinese culture and rapid modernization provides fertile ground for documentary exploration. Hefei Documentary Cinematographers frequently focus on themes such as urban development, environmental changes, cultural preservation, and the human impact of technological advancement. Their work often features the beautiful landscapes surrounding Hefei, including Chaohu Lake—one of China’s five largest freshwater lakes—and the Dabie Mountains, providing stunning backdrops for their narratives.
